They are unsorted. You can visit the Pandas Documentation to learn more about to_frame(). In this tutorial, you’ll see how to convert Pandas Series to a DataFrame. The labels need not be unique but must be a hashable type. You can access a single value from a DataFrame in two ways. In this tutorial we will learn the different ways to create a series in python pandas (create empty series, series from array without index, series from array with index, series from list, series from dictionary and scalar value ). Use at if you only need to get or set a single value in a DataFrame or Series." Series also … In this tutorial, we will introduce how to replace column values in Pandas DataFrame. index. That means that when you append items one by one, you create two more arrays of the n+1 size on each step. Any arithmetic operation on series is applied to all the values of the series. Method 2: Or you can use DataFrame.iat(row_position, column_position) to access the value present in the location represented by the row position row_position and column position column_position, irrespective of the row and column labels. The follow two approaches both follow this row & column idea. As pandas was developed in the context of financial modeling, it contains a comprehensive set of tools for working with dates, times, and time-indexed data. Vocabulary words we must know: If no index is provided, you can consider index to be starting at 0 and increment in steps of 1 with each successive row. The difference is, while return statement returns a value and the function ends, yield statement can return a sequence of values, it sort of yields, hence the name. at - Access a single value for a row/column label pair Use at if you only need to get or set a single value in a DataFrame or Series. You can get the first row with iloc[0] and the last row with iloc[-1].. You can convert Pandas DataFrame to Series using squeeze: df.squeeze() In this guide, you’ll see 3 scenarios of converting: Single DataFrame column into a Series (from a single-column DataFrame) Specific DataFrame column into a Series (from a multi-column DataFrame) Single row in the DataFrame into a Series After filtering you get one item Series, so for select first value is possible use iat:. Pandas is one of those packages and makes importing and analyzing data much easier. Python Programming. Let's examine a few of the common techniques. Quickly retrieve single value at passed index label. We want to sort the revenues in ascending order. pandas.Series.loc¶ property Series.loc¶. the sum of values along with columns or along rows in the Dataframe. For rows we set parameter axis=0 and for column we set axis=1 (by default axis is 0). Is that any way that I can get first element of Seires without have information on index. Method 1: DataFrame. Explanation: In this example, an empty pandas series data structure is created first then the data structure is loaded with values using a copy function. Syntax: Series.get (key, default=None) Parameter : key : object. Axis for the function to be applied on. index keyword argument assigns label to different values of series. iloc is the most efficient way to get a value from the cell of a Pandas dataframe. ['a', 'b', 'c']. If we select one column, it will return a series. Access a group of rows and columns by label(s) or a boolean array..loc[] is primarily label based, but may also be used with a boolean array. Most of these are aggregations like sum(), mean(), but some of them, like sumsum(), produce an object of the same size.Generally speaking, these methods take an axis argument, just like ndarray. pandas.Series. Extracting a column of a pandas dataframe ¶ df2.loc[: , "2005"] To extract a column you can also do: df2["2005"] Note that when you extract a single row or column, you get a one-dimensional object as output. Allowed inputs are: A single label, e.g. Let’s create a Dataframe first. The index parameter accepts array-like objects which will allow you to label your index axis. Series is a one-dimensional labeled array in pandas capable of holding data of any type (integer, string, float, python objects, etc.). Pandas : Get frequency of a value in dataframe column/index & find its positions in Python; How to convert Dataframe column type from string to date time; Pandas : Get unique values in columns of a Dataframe in Python; Pandas: Convert a dataframe column into a list using Series.to_list() or numpy.ndarray.tolist() in python But what if you’re treating a CSV like a basic database and you need to update a cell value? A list or array of labels, e.g. A Series is like a fixed-size dictionary in that you can get and set values by index label. Method 1: DataFrame.at[index, column_name] property returns a single value present in the row represented by the index and in the column represented by the column name. Pandas – Replace Values in Column based on Condition. Ionic 2 - how to make ion-button with icon and text on two lines? ['col_name'].values[] is also a solution especially if we don’t want to get the return type as pandas.Series. It is generally the most commonly used pandas object. Pandas Series - at property: The at property is used to access a single value for a row/column label pair. The values can be contained in a tuple, list, one-dimensional NumPy array, Pandas Series object, or one of several other data types. If you specify only one line using iloc, you can get the line as pandas.Series.pandas.Series is easier to get the value. DataFrame – Access a Single Value. iloc. When you add to Series an item with a label that is missing in the index, a new index with size n+1 is created, and a new values values array of the same size. It’s possible to control the order of the columns with the columns parameter and the row labels with index: >>> >>> Big Data Zone ... big data, python, pandas, null values, tutorial. Selecting multiple columns by label. Pandas is an essential tool for any data analyst. Pandas Series.get_values() function return an ndarray containing the underlying data of the given series object. _values [label] # Similar to Index.get_value, but we do not fall back to positional: loc = self. To get individual cell values, we need to use the intersection of rows and columns. Getting a Single Value. Return boolean if values in the object are monotonic_increasing. If ‘label’ does not exist in DataFrame. So, it returned the sum of values in the 4th column i.e. In this case, the index of the Pandas Series will be the keys of the dictionary and the values will be the values of the dictionary. pandas.Series.gt¶ Series.gt (other, level = None, fill_value = None, axis = 0) [source] ¶ Return Greater than of series and other, element-wise (binary operator gt).. We can select multiple columns of a data frame by passing in a … Pandas for time series analysis. .drop Method to Delete Row on Column Value in Pandas dataframe.drop method accepts a single or list of columns’ names and deletes the rows or columns. The index (axis labels) of the Series. That means that when you append items one by one, you create two more arrays of the n+1 size on each step. the values which are about to be needed are held as a list then that list is copied into the pandas series.After the copy process is done the series is printed onto the console. is_monotonic. iat ( row_position, column_position) to access the value present in the location represented by the row position … index. In this post, I’m going to review slicing, which is a core Python topic, but has a few subtle issues related to pandas. DataFrame’s columns are Pandas Series. If you want just the value and not a df/series then call values and index the first element [0] ... _group = purchase_group.squeeze() would make it into a series so you could simply call purchase_group['Column_name'] to get your values. Let’s get information out of this series. Like Series, DataFrame accepts many different kinds of input: Pandas dataframe.get_value () function is used to quickly retrieve single value in the data frame at passed column and index. It can be inferred that a Pandas Series is like a … In [8]: revenue['2016'] Out[8]: 1500. value_counts() method can be applied only to series but what if you want to get the unique value count for multiple columns? You can access a single value from a DataFrame in two ways. I wish pandas was a bit more forgiving when generating colors for labels, but oh well. Method 1: DataFrame.at[index, column_name] property returns a single value present in the row represented by the index and in the column represented by the column name. The output is a Numpy array. Another intestering question is about the speed of both methods in comparison. How to get index and values of series in Pandas? iloc is the most efficient way to get a value from the cell of a Pandas dataframe. The axis labels are collectively called index. Notice again that the items in the output are de-duped … the duplicates are removed. Values in a Series can be retrieved in two general ways: by index label or by 0-based position. more specifically the first element of the series is also printed. ... Once you run the code, you’ll get this single DataFrame: Additional Resources. Here are the top 35 commands and operations to get you started. If you haven’t read it yet, see the first post that covers the basics of selecting based on index or relative numerical indexing. The data parameter can accept several different data types such as ndarray, dictionaries and scalar values. A quicker way to get min and max date from pandas series Hi all, I've got a 'Date' column of the format 'mm/dd/yyyy' and I want to get the min and max … Moreover, they appear in the exact same order as they appeared in the input. column ‘Score’. The above Python snippet shows the constructor for a Pandas Series. The input to the function is the row label and the column label. pandas.Series.loc¶ property Series.loc¶. Know more about: Selecting columns by the number from dataframe using the iloc [] at [ index, column_name] property returns a single value present in the row represented by the index and in the column represented by the column name. Check it out. pandas get cell values. pandas get cell values To get individual cell values, we need to use the intersection of rows and columns. BeatifulSoup, How reorganize a group of div , pure JavaScript, Rendering multiple tables are same time causes issue on display in data tables(UI), Multi-tenant architecture with Sequelize and MySQL, Setting nativeElement.scrollTop is not working in android app in angular, How to pass token to verify user across html pages using node js, How to add css animation keyframe to jointjs element, Change WooCommerce phone number link on emails, I have a set of python files and a main file which called those other filespython files import pandas and gspread, I like do a stem-plit with Pythons matplotlib where the figure has a legend box where the labels are colored like the stemsAt the moment I only get a legend where the label text is the normal black and has a short stem plot on the left, I have this code to connect client-server in Python to MATLAB, typescript: tsc is not recognized as an internal or external command, operable program or batch file, In Chrome 55, prevent showing Download button for HTML 5 video, RxJS5 - error - TypeError: You provided an invalid object where a stream was expected. Raises. The follow two approaches both follow this row & column idea.

Midge Emerger Patterns, Wilson Omni Antenna, Townhomes For Sale In Dubuque Iowa, Advantages And Disadvantages Of Investing In Silver, Walgreens All Purpose Cleaner, Baskin Robbins Icecreams, Rocko's Modern Life Banned Episode, Quarterdeck Resort Owner, Sinopsis Penuh Pulang,